INSTRUCTOR Applications







We are always looking to expand our programming at the Art Center. Do you have an idea for a workshop or would you like to teach a class for a semester? If you'd like to join our team as an instructor please submit the following to jobs@whitemarsharts.org


1. A resume listing your education and teaching background.


2. A list of a few courses you are qualified to teach. Please include at least one course that's different than what we currently offer.


3. The estimated number of hours each proposed course needs per class and the weekdays and times you would currently be available to teach that course. We realize that your times and availability are subject to change.


4. Most of our courses are taught in-person or live online. However, if we are considering hiring you for an online course that includes video tutorials, we may request a 5-minute video tutorial example.


5. Prior to finalizing a teaching contract, we will request contact information of two references. Ideally, these should be people who can speak to your experience as an arts educator. Supervisors preferred.


6. Instructors will be required to complete all PA Department of Human Services mandated clearance background checks prior to teaching.


7. Please submit applications to jobs (at) whitemarsharts.org addressed to "hiring manager." All initial correspondence will be by email. Please no calls, letters, or emails to our other email addresses.
